Fort Valley State announces 2006 Football
Schedule
April 21, 2006
The Fort Valley State University Department of Athletics has
released its schedule for the 2006 football season.
A total of 10 games, seven of them counting towards play in
the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Conference, are on the
docket. Two SIAC teams (Morehouse and Kentucky State) are on
the schedule, but those games will not count towards Fort Valley’s
record in conference play.
Football action will kick off in Atlanta, Georgia when the
Wildcats face the Panthers of Clark Atlanta University on the
CAU campus (8/26). The first of two games in Wildcat Stadium
will be played when the Wildcats host the Maroon Tigers of
Morehouse College (9/2). That game will also be celebrated
as Medical Professionals/Military Appreciation Day. After the
game against Morehouse, the Wildcats will then travel to Valdosta,
Georgia to face the Blazers of Valdosta State University (9/9).
The Wildcats will stay on the road the following week (9/16)
as they travel to Birmingham, Alabama to play the Golden Bears
of Miles College. Fort Valley’s final game during the
month of September (9/23) will be against the Golden Tigers
of Tuskegee University in Macon, Georgia.
Fort Valley State will open the month of October with another
trip to Alabama, this time to the city of Tuscaloosa to play
the Tigers of Stillman College (10/7). After an open date,
the grandest occasion on a college campus (Homecoming) will
be celebrated when the Wildcats host the Tigers of Benedict
College (10/21). Jackson, Tennessee will be the site of Fort
Valley’s next game as the Wildcats take on the Dragons
of Lane College (10/28).
November will see the Wildcats play two games. The first
(11/4) will pit the Wildcats against the Golden Rams of Albany
State University in the 17th edition of the Fountain City Classic.
That game, now considered by many to be one of bigger games
in the Southeast, will be played at McClung-Memorial Stadium
in Columbus, Georgia. Fort Valley State will close out regular
season play on Nov. 11 when the Wildcats travel to Frankfort,
Kentucky to play the Thorobreds of Kentucky State University.
Last season, the Wildcats were 7-3 overall and were third in
the SIAC with a 5-2 record.
